Today we are interviewing Tony Churchill, who happens to be Dorina's running coach from high school. He coached track, soccer, baseball, basketball, wrestling and tennis. He’s been coaching and teaching for more than 35 years. Now he lives in Wisconsin with his wife Shelly near his daughter and four grandchildren. He also has two sons. Tony continues to teach today at a correctional facility. We chat with him about his coaching philosophy, reminisce about the glory days when I ran Track and played soccer in high school, and how Scripture inspires him. . In this episode, we interview Carolyn Su. She is a runner mama of 2, who is on the November 2020 cover of Runner's World magazine. She is an advocate for diversity in running and creating safe spaces for all people to run. We really enjoyed this conversation we had with Carolyn. We chatted about sanctification through injuries, disordered eating, working for equity in the running world, and experiencing God through Creation.
